Transaction 22593df6b95607d51a3bc5243ba690b6525d6dec40a3a2daf2cc88b54671fe9e
1 Input
1 Output
-
22593df6b95607d51a3bc5243ba690b6525d6dec40a3a2daf2cc88b54671fe9e:0
- value
- 998468
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b1ee444a7a429e714c4907dc1a87bda25e4c588 OP_EQUAL
- address
- 375coFcdoNSq7D9dBXkhxhZBs8Q3mAPDG7